MQ-9 Reaper Replacement: Air Force's $10M Drone Plan

The US Air Force is accelerating a program to field a cheaper MQ-9 Reaper successor after losing 45 of the drones — about 25% of its fleet — during Operation Epic Fury against Iran, officials said on September 4, 2026. The new Massed Modular Aircraft (MMA) program targets a $10 million price per airframe, roughly a fifth of what a fully equipped MQ-9A costs today, and aims to field an initial batch of 20 aircraft years sooner than originally planned.
Background: A Fleet Worn Down Over Iran
The MQ-9 Reaper, built by General Atomics, has been the US military's primary hunter-killer drone for nearly two decades, flying long-endurance intelligence, surveillance, and strike missions once reserved for crewed aircraft. Its Achilles' heel has always been survivability: the Reaper is a slow-moving, unstealthy aircraft designed for permissive airspace, not for operating against an adversary with modern air defenses.
Operation Epic Fury, the US military campaign against Iran launched February 28, 2026, exposed that weakness at scale. As of mid-August, the Pentagon had lost 45 Reapers in the operation — a quarter of the roughly 180-aircraft fleet the Air Force had before the campaign began, shrinking the active inventory to about 135 airframes. Losses of that magnitude, on a jet that costs $30 million to $50 million depending on its sensor and weapons package, forced planners to rethink how fast a successor needed to arrive.
This is the same dynamic reshaping military drone procurement worldwide: cheap, expendable unmanned aircraft are proving they can inflict — and absorb — losses that would once have been unthinkable for expensive crewed or semi-crewed platforms.
The Massed Modular Aircraft Program
The Air Force is developing the MMA with the goal of building large numbers of "attritable" drones — aircraft cheap and simple enough to lose in combat without derailing a campaign, unlike the Reaper.

The $10 million target covers the air vehicle alone; sensors, weapons, and other mission equipment are priced separately, so a fully equipped MMA will cost more than that headline figure. Even so, the gap to a fully loaded MQ-9A is wide enough to let the Air Force buy several MMAs for the price of one Reaper.
Why the Air Force Is Moving Faster
"We want to bring this thing forward because of the fact that, although we have plenty of MQ-9As today, we are going through them at a rate that is concerning to us," Lt. Gen. Christopher Niemi, the Air Force's chief modernization officer, said of the accelerated timeline. Niemi also acknowledged the trade-off built into the program: reaching a $10 million price point means the service will "certainly give up something" in capability compared with the Reaper.
Lt. Gen. Luke Cropsey, the Air Force's military deputy for acquisitions, said the service is applying open government reference architectures to the clean-sheet design from the outset, so that vendors compete to build compliant hardware rather than locking the Air Force into a single manufacturer's proprietary system — a lesson drawn partly from how long it has taken to adapt the Reaper's closed architecture to new threats.
The Air Force originally planned a 21-month gap between a contract award and a full-scale MMA prototype, with fielding not expected until 2031. Officials are now pushing to compress that schedule, aiming to get aircraft into service years earlier in response to the pace of losses over Iran.
What This Means for Drone Pilots Worldwide
Nobody outside the military will fly an MMA, but the program marks a turning point that touches the drone industry well beyond the Pentagon.
First, it validates a shift the industry has been signaling for two years: high-cost, exquisite aircraft are losing ground to cheaper, expendable designs built to be produced — and lost — in volume. The same "attritable" logic is already driving smaller counter-drone and loitering-munition programs across the US defense industrial base, and it is the design philosophy behind swarming drone concepts increasingly discussed for both military and civilian disaster-response use.
Second, expect intensified competition among US and allied drone manufacturers for MMA contracts. General Atomics, which has built every Reaper variant since the program began, is not guaranteed the MMA win; the open-architecture approach is explicitly designed to let newer, smaller drone makers compete on cost rather than incumbency.
Third, for allied air forces that operate or plan to operate the MQ-9B SkyGuardian/SeaGuardian family — including the UK, Australia, Japan, and several NATO members — a US pivot toward cheaper attritable drones is likely to shape what Washington offers for export in the next decade, and could pressure allied procurement plans to follow suit.
